Mastering Harmonica Tabs: A Beginner's Guide
Wiki Article
Embarking upon your harmonica journey can be an exhilarating experience. One of the initial hurdles many beginners encounter is understanding harmonica tabs, the specialized musical notation system used to represent harmonica playing. Fortunately, deciphering these tabs is simpler than it may seem at first glance.
- Begin by familiarizing yourself with the basic layout of a harmonica tab. Harmonica tabs usually use numbers to indicate the different holes on a harmonica, with hole 1 being the lowest note and hole 10 the highest.
- Practice reading tabs slowly and methodically, paying attention to the hole assigned to each note. Remember that a number above a line signifies blowing into the hole, while a number below a line implies drawing air through the hole.
- Refrain from getting overwhelmed if you encounter difficult tabs right away. Start with simpler melodies and gradually progress to more intricate pieces as your skills improve.
